On the NOVA processing scale, Digestives Milk Chocolate Flavor coating is classified as Group 4 (Ultra-processed). NOVA measures industrial processing intensity rather than ingredient-level safety, so it complements the SAFFA and CSPI ratings: a product can be clean on additive flags but heavily processed, or lightly processed but carry individually flagged ingredients. Combining both lenses gives a fuller picture than either alone. The Nutri-Score grade of E reflects nutritional balance, calories, saturated fat, sugar, sodium versus fiber, protein, and produce content, which again is a distinct dimension from additive safety and worth weighing alongside the scores above.

Full Ingredient List

Wheat flour, compound coating (sugar, cocoa butter, chocolate, skim milk, whey, butteroil, vegetable shortening [contains one or more of the following: shea oil, illipe oil, sal oil, palm oil, mango kernel oil, kokum oil], soy lecithin, polyglycerol polyricinoleate, natural flavor.) palm oil, whole wheat flour, sugar, glucose syrup, tartaric acid, malic acid, leavening (sodium bicarbonate, ammonium bicarbonate), salt, calcium carbonate, calcium sulfate, reduced iron, nicotinamide, thiamine hydrochloride.
